NOISE ABATEMENT PROCEDURES
| Noise sensitive area all quadrants. Request that pilots use best
FAA/Company noise abatement procedures. Pilots requested to minimize
use of reverse thrust consistent with the safe operation of the
aircraft to minimize noise impact on the surrounding community. |
AIRPORT CURFEWS
|
- No noise-related arrival curfew.
- All takeoffs prohibited 11:30 pm - 6:30 am.
- Takeoff prohibited 10 pm -11:30 pm and 6:30 am - 7:00 am for
aircraft not Stage 3 certificated per FAR 36 or aircraft exceeding
104 EPNdB at the takeoff reference point per AC 36-1H or AC 36-2C
are prohibited.
Exceptions are permitted for emergency and mercy flights only.
The operator is required to provide written documentation within
72 hours after the operation occurs.
For violations of the time of day (Noise curfew) requirements,
the operator may be assessed $1000 for the first violation per
calendar quarter, $3000 for a second violation per calendar quarter
and $5000 for a third violation per calendar quarter. In the later
case, operating privileges may be terminated permanently.
Note: Effective July 1, 2006, the time-of-day noise curfew violation
fine structure will change. The new fine structure will be: For
violations of the time-of-day (noise curfew) restrictions at SDIA,
the operator may be assessed $2,000 for the first infraction in
a violation period (6 calendar months), $6,000 for a second infraction
per violation period and $10,000 for a third infraction per violation
period. Additionally, a multiplier factor will be assessed to
the violation amounts noted above against operators based on the
number of penalized violations in the previous six calendar months.
Termination of operating privileges after three infractions in
a single (6 month) violation period is still an option.

ENGINE RUN-UP RESTRICTIONS
| Engine run-ups at power setting above idle are not allowed between
11:30 pm and 6:30 am except in conjunction with emergency or mercy
operations. |

NOISE MONITORING SYSTEM
Click here for larger view of
noise monitoring system
| In October 2006, the San Diego County Regional Airport Authority
completed the upgrade of the Lochard Airport Noise and Operations
Monitoring System (ANOMS). Twenty four (24) state of the art noise
monitors are now part of the ANOMS, as well as a near real-time
flight tracking internet website that is available to the noise-impacted
community to address overflight and noise complaint issues. There
are fourteen noise monitors west of the airport and ten noise monitors
east of the airport. Eleven of the twenty-five noise monitors use
solar power, and all 25 noise monitors transmit data via wireless
modem technology. Among other things, the noise monitor data provides
the basis of the CNEL noise contours and the Time of Day Restrictions
(Curfew). |

STAGE 2 RESTRICTIONS
| Takeoff prohibited 10 pm -11:30 pm and 6:30 am - 7:00 am for aircraft
not Stage 3 certificated per FAR 36. Aircraft exceeding 104 EPNdB
at the takeoff reference point per AC 36-1H or AC 36-2C are prohibited
from operating at SAN. |
